Stop leak is the worst repair tool to ever be marketed, all it does it plug your radiator tubes and you still have a leak somewhere.

Is this a Cummins or Gasser? Either way repair is the best solution. Cummins would have a few more aftermarket options. What I usually do is buy the expandable plugs from napa or similar.

Cummins had a series of bad block castings the are known for cracking under the exhaust manifold, but typically don't hear of them in the 12v application, only 24v
